MLS News: Earthquakes acquire MF Eduard Lowen from St. Louis City

Add to Favorite
Added to Favorite


The San Jose Earthquakes acquired playmaking midfielder Eduard Lowen from St. Louis City on Wednesday for $425,000 in general allocation money and up to $500,000 in conditional GAM, pending performance-based incentives.

Lowen, 29, was in his fourth season with St. Louis City and had 20 goals and 27 assists in 84 MLS matches (70 starts). He had 17 assists in 2023 when then-expansion St. Louis City finished first in the Western Conference.

“I’m very thankful for this new chapter in my life and career moving to the Bay Area and joining the Earthquakes,” Lowen said in a news release. “I’ll always be grateful for the amazing time I had in St. Louis.

“I’m excited to build new relationships here in the community and am determined to help this team make a strong playoff push and be successful with this historic club.”

San Jose coach Bruce Arena expects Lowen to be a difference-maker.

“Eduard is a proven player in this league with the versatility and experience to make an impact in our midfield,” Arena said in a news release. “Beyond what he brings on the field, he’s a great person with strong character and leadership qualities. We’re excited to have him in San Jose and look forward to welcoming him to the club.”

Lowen had three goals and three assists in 13 matches (eight starts) this season.

“Decisions like this are never easy, but we are incredibly grateful for everything Edu has given to this club and for the player and person he has shown himself to be throughout his time in St. Louis,” St. Louis City sporting director Corey Wray said in a news release.

Lowen played for Germany’s 2020 Olympic team and his club stops include playing four seasons (2017-21) in the Bundesliga.

San Jose visits the Houston Dynamo on Saturday.
